虚拟局域网设置与管理:如何在Linux中配置VLAN?

时间:2025-12-07 分类:操作系统

虚拟局域网(VLAN)技术在现代网络架构中扮演着重要的角色,尤其是在企业环境和数据中心。通过将网络划分为多个逻辑部分,VLAN能够有效提高网络的效率、安全性和管理性。对于Linux用户来说,配置和管理VLAN是一项必要的技能,能够为网络拓扑结构提供灵活性和可扩展性。

虚拟局域网设置与管理:如何在Linux中配置VLAN?

在Linux环境中,配置VLAN的方法相对灵活,通常使用`ip`命令或`vconfig`命令来设置。现代的Linux发行版全面支持VLAN,有些甚至内置了图形用户界面工具来简化这一过程。随着网络性能的不断提升和安防需求的增加,对VLAN的使用也变得越来越普及。

VLAN的基本概念

VLAN是一种通过逻辑分割将物理网络划分为多个虚拟局域网的技术。不同VLAN中的设备可以在同一个物理网络中操作,但互相之间的通信受到限制,只有通过路由器或三层交换机进行。这样,网络管理员可以通过VLAN来提高安全性和优化网络流量。

在Linux中配置VLAN

Linux提供了多种方法配置VLAN,以下是较为常见的方式:

1. 使用`ip`命令:

bash

ip link add link eth0 name eth0.100 type vlan id 100

ip addr add 192.168.1.1/24 dev eth0.100

ip link set dev eth0.100 up

2. 使用`vconfig`命令(虽然此工具已在较新的Linux版本中被`ip`命令取代,但仍然一些用户可能会使用):

bash

vconfig add eth0 100

ifconfig eth0.100 192.168.1.1 netmask 255.255.255.0 up

以上两种方法分别演示了如何创建VLAN和配置IP地址。使用`ip`命令的方式更为现代且被广泛推荐。

VLAN的优势

1. 安全性:通过将敏感数据传输隔离在不同的VLAN内,网络安全性得以提高,避免了潜在的数据泄漏。

2. 流量管理:VLAN可以显著减少广播域的规模,从而减少网络拥堵,提高整体性能。

3. 灵活的网络设计:不同部门或项目组可以在同一物理网路中设置各自的VLAN,快速调整网络结构。

性能评测与市场趋势

新的网络协议如802.1Q VLAN标记法正在迅速普及,特别是在云计算和虚拟化的背景下,VLAN配置与管理的重要性不断上升。网络设备制造商也在不断推出支持高级VLAN功能的交换机和路由器,以适应不断增长的市场需求。

对于DIY网络组装者来说,合理配置VLAN不仅可以提升网络性能,还有助于更好地管理家庭或商业网络。通过掌握这一技术,用户可以更轻松地进行网络优化,实现对不同应用场景的适配。

常见问题解答

1. 什么是VLAN?

VLAN是一种技术,通过逻辑方式将一个物理局域网划分为多个虚拟局域网。

2. 在Linux中如何配置VLAN?

可以使用`ip`命令或`vconfig`命令来创建和管理VLAN。

3. VLAN的主要优势是什么?

VLAN能够提高网络安全性、减少广播流量,并灵活调整网络结构。

4. VLAN支持哪些设备?

现代的交换机、路由器和服务器均支持VLAN配置。

5. 可以在家庭网络中使用VLAN吗?

是的,使用VLAN可以为家庭用户提供更好的网络管理和安全性。